Preparation for Installation



When getting ready for the setup of a heat pump in your home, it's vital to begin with an extensive strategy. Start by assessing your home's home heating and cooling down demands. Consider aspects such as the dimension of your home, insulation quality, and regional environment. This assessment will help determine the proper size and sort of heatpump for your area.

Next, establish a budget for the task, including not only the expense of the heat pump itself however also installment expenses, permits, and any type of needed upgrades to your electrical system.

Study credible a/c companies in your location and collect multiple quotes to contrast pricing and services offered. It's vital to pick a qualified and skilled specialist to make certain the installment is done correctly.

As soon as you have actually chosen a service provider, timetable a site check out for them to evaluate your home and supply a comprehensive installation strategy. See to it to talk about any details needs or choices you have for the setup procedure.

Screening and Maintenance



As soon as the heatpump installment is total, it's essential to perform regular screening and upkeep to make certain ideal performance and longevity of the system.

Start by checking the filters every one to three months, cleaning or replacing them as required to keep efficiency.



Check the outside unit for particles or blockages that might restrain air flow, and clear any kind of greenery or items around it.

Evaluate the thermostat settings, calibrating if essential, and make certain the temperature analyses are exact.

Look for any kind of uncommon noises, vibrations, or smells during operation, as these can indicate underlying issues.

Arrange specialist maintenance a minimum of annually to evaluate and tune up the system, guaranteeing all components are working correctly.

Routine maintenance not just boosts effectiveness however also extends the life-span of your heat pump, conserving you money over time.
